April, 2012: SchoolCenter PictureConnie Hoffstetter Named Public Health Hero for 2012

Connie Hoffstetter, school nurse with Bend-La Pine Schools for 12 years, was selected as the Public Health Hero for 2012 by the Deschutes County Public Health Advisory Board for her demonstrated excellence in promoting and protecting public health. The advisory board said, "Connie has ensured that students have an outlet for health and wellness and has made an impact in addressing the needs of students with asthma and establishing a school-based health center in La Pine.  Nurse Connie has become a role model for the students that are looking to further their careers in the health care industry."  Congratulations!



April, 2012: SchoolCenter PicturePeter Hawkins Named 2012 Inspirational Teacher

Summit High School's Peter Hawkins was selected as one of the 2012 Inspirational Teacher award recipients by the University of Washington's Computer Science and Engineering department.  The award is for teachers from any discipline whom their undergraduate students nominated as having been particularly inspirational.  A banquet celebration will be held on May 10, 2012.  Congratulations!

"The greatest strength of Hawkins is that he cares tremendously about his students.  Every lecture was carefully thought out, and every question was answered with care, even though those answers were often (purposefully) nebulous at best." 
~ Former student, Brian Donahue
